Company Description

The General Sales Manager is responsible for the overall day to day operations of their branch. In addition they are to drive and develop world class retail execution, best in class sales & operational process & systems, and building a winning team that epitomizes RBDC standard and culture.

Job Description

MANAGING EXPECTATIONS

Lead, coach, and develop a highly capable team to ensure operational objectives are met or exceeded and that sales and distribution targets are flawlessly executed to standard

Build a platform on which high potential candidates can develop and prepare for future roles of additional responsibility

Manage operating processes/ expenses to deliver targeted profitability

EXECUTION

Develop, and continually evaluate, branch distribution plans, routes, new item distribution, and volume / sales forecast

Evaluate total market conditions, competitive threats, and changing local dynamics which may impact volume, share, profit, as well as other business metrics

Develop KPI priorities, strategies, and goals for the branch by coordinating with cross functional departments, to ensure the attainment of volume plan and profit objectives

BUILDING SUCCESS

Collaborate with members of the RBNA Sales and DP Team’s to develop and execute programs

Work collaboratively across the organization and share best practices

Act as a major contributor/leader among peer group

Build a diverse organization that reflects the marketplace; lives to Red Bull’s values and inspires team through effective leadership

Ensure the Branch Team understands and adheres to Company standards and operating procedures
 

Qualifications

8+ years of experience in Direct Store Delivery (DSD) management, including proven track record of meeting or exceeding assigned sales objectives

Key account management experience on a district, regional and national level

A proven track record of being able to motivate and build a successful sales team and promote initiatives that build and create strong trade partnerships

Strong leadership skills to provide mentoring, training or corrective feedback

Excellent verbal and written communication skills, including being able to prepare presentation materials and present the information one-on-one and in a group

Strong computer skills in Microsoft Word, Power Point, and Excel

Demonstrated analytical and organizational skills

Previous P&L experience and an understanding of computer ordering systems and other IT systems

English; additional languages an advantage
